Empirical Likelihood Inference for Random Coefficient INAR(p) Process

In this paper, we study the empirical likelihood method for the pth-order random coefficient integer-valued autoregressive process. In particular, the limiting distribution of the log empirical likelihood ratio statistic is established and the confidence regions for the parameter of interest are derived. Also a simulation study is conducted for the evaluation of the developed approach.
Keywords:Models of count data;Random coefficient;INAR process;Empirical likelihood;Asymptotic distribution
